Analysis

In 2019, government expenditure on post-secondary non-tertiary education, ppp$ in Bangladesh stood at 247.52 millions. That is the highest value across all 15 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 10.7% on the previous year and up 156.1% over ten years.

Over the whole period, government expenditure on post-secondary non-tertiary education, ppp$ in Bangladesh peaked at 247.52 millions in 2019 and was at its lowest, 0 millions, in 2002.

That places Bangladesh 16th out of 91 countries with data for 2019, putting it in the top qu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Government expenditure on post-secondary non-tertiary education, PPP$ in Bangladesh, year by year

Annual values for Government expenditure on post-secondary non-tertiary education, PPP$ (millions) in Bangladesh, 1999 to 2019.
Year millions Change
1999 5.29 millions
2000 5.38 millions +1.6%
2001 7.03 millions +30.6%
2002 0 millions -100.0%
2003 0 millions
2004 0 millions
2006 87.99 millions
2007 88.45 millions +0.5%
2008 111.89 millions +26.5%
2009 96.63 millions -13.6%
2010 122.8 millions +27.1%
2011 109.36 millions -10.9%
2012 133.15 millions +21.8%
2016 223.56 millions +67.9%
2019 247.52 millions +10.7%

Total general (local, regional and central) government expenditure on post-secondary non-tertiary education (current, capital, and transfers), in millions PPP$ (at purchasing power parity), in nominal value. It includes expenditure funded by transfers from international sources to government. Total government expenditure for a given level of education (e.g. primary, secondary, or all levels combined) in national currency is converted to PPP$. Limitations: In some instances data on total government expenditure on education refers only to the Ministry of Education, excluding other ministries which may also spend a part of their budget on educational activities.
